THE N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LERWhat happens when an unadventurous adventure writer tries to re-create the original expedition to Machu Picchu? In 1911, Hiram Bingham III climbed into the Andes Mountains of Peru and discovered Machu Picchu. While history has recast Bingham as a villain who stole both priceless artifacts and credit for finding the great archeological site, Mark Adams set out to retrace the explorers perilous path in search of the truth--except hed written about adventure far more than hed actually lived it. In fact, hed never even slept in a tent. Turn Right at Machu Picchu is Adams fascinating and funny account of his journey through some of the worlds most majestic, historic, and remote landscapes guided only by a hard-as-nails Australian survivalist and one nagging question: Just what was Machu Picchu?
